Hello,

I have 4 different units in my home and all of them are giving me a temperature which is around 3° above the exact value. I did not find any option in the Daikin app to kind of "calibrate" the temperature.

As I'm only controlling the units via HomeKit, I was wondering if it would be useful (or not) to have an option to adjust the temperature. For example, under the option to define the temperature unit in Homebridge, we could have another option "Temperature adjustment" that would be 0 by default, and then I could input a value of -3 for example. And finally, all the commands that are sent to the units would use this adjustment.

Maybe I'm missing something obvious, but do you think it would be something feasible?
